    ok so we are now more than 2/3rds done with the season. there is less than 2 weeks to go before the trade deadlines ends. who are your team(s)? do you think your team will make the playoffs?

    for me i am a huge LA Kings fan. been following them since Gretzky came to LA. my team has won 2 cups since then (2012 and 2014). we have only 4 players left from those cup teams. we have a nice mix of young and veteran players, but the team is made up of mostly young players. we made the playoffs for the first time in 5 years or so last year. we did not make it out of the first round. today we are only a point away from 1st place Vegas in the Pacific division. i think we should go pretty far. but i think we are kind of shaky at goaltending. Pheonix Copley has stepped in admirably. but he has no playoff experience and Quick is starting to show some slowing down.

    dustin brown had his number retired to the rafters and just got a statue put up at Crypto.com Arena .....formally known as Staples center. he retired last year. he was one of my favorite players. when he first came up, he was all body. he currently holds the most hits in team history! he had many many hits like that thru his career.

    now days it is more about speed and puck handling which is more entertaining.
